Medina County Ranch for Sale - 187 Acres of Real Estate

June 16th, 2011

Medina County offers a great lifestyle and quality wildlife habitat making real estate in the area highly coveted. This 187 acre Medina County ranch has terrain that is flat to rolling with sandy loam soils. The property is loaded with beautiful live oak, hickory, Spanish oak, post oak, hackberry, southern sumac, yaupon holly, muscadine grapes and bull mesquite. This property is quite attractive to whitetail deer, providing a variety of high protein browse to eat and native grasses. For livestock, this ranch also has some improved pastures (about 25 acres of coastal Bermuda).

Wildlife on this Medina County ranch is diverse. Native wildlife on the property is abundant and includes whitetail deer, Rio Grande turkey, mourning dove, bowhite quail and feral hogs. Wildlife flock to the 5 nice ponds that complete this smaller, yet complete piece of real estate. In addition, there is one well on an electric submersible pump with sand filter and separator, which supplies water to 3 of the ponds and 2 water troughs. Three of the ponds are stocked with largemouth bass and channel catfish.

This ranch is located off of IH-35 and CR 7812, approximately 5 miles southeast of Devine and 30 minutes from San Antonio, in Medina County. All roads are blacktop asphalt from IH-35 south and the county road to the ranch gate entrance. Priced at $701,250. 104 Acre Llano County Ranch Land for Sale

March 31st, 2011

This 104 acres of Llano County land is a very scenic property located about 15 minutes west of Llano. This ranch will be cut out of a 208 acre ranch and offers a seasonal creek through the middle of it with granite outcrops in the creek, beautiful live oak and post oak trees along with with mesquite and persimmons, an old rock wall, old home site and barn, old hand dug well with rocked inside wall, old windmill and 17 gallon per minute capped newer well and some great hill country views. The ranch is located on CR 103 about a mile off Highway 29 and a mile from the Llano River, which offers great fishing and other outdoor recreational opportunities.

This Llano County ranch does not have electricity, but it is readily available from adjacent ranches. Another adjacent 104 acres are also available that have a great stock tank that held water through even the most recent drought. This additional land for sale has great granite outcroppings and beautiful views of local mountains. This ranch is listed at $468,000.
